LOCT the series:
Because my story/series will not follow an original story of the starwars universe rather it'll be a new story of its own basing its lore and history more into clone troopers and what their lives are like, and the part of them you haven't seen. The time period for this series will be based long after the clone wars and the extinction of most of the jedi's and sith. The remaining of them are now exiles and are to be killed on site by the order of the federation, the federation is now the greatest authority in the galaxy.

I call this time period,  "The galactic federation period" the republic is now controlled by the federation and special sectors of chosen planets.the empire is no more the empire now only co-exists and has been mostly claimed by the federation and since then a lot has changed, the original members of the empire are either imprisoned, thrown into the outter rim or work for the Federation under surveillance.

Rebellions and rebels exist now more than ever and the clones fight them off often.

Bounty hunters and pirates, along with smugglers will be seen in this series.

Re: Life of a Clone Trooper The Series UPDATE/PRODUCTION Thread.

The set is dark and bland.  The light starts darkish and then its suddenly bright.  Its as if you shot the first few seconds one day then came back the next day with a different light configuration.  Light flicker is bad but its usually consistantly bad throughout.  Yours is inconsistent making me think it was shot over multiple days/sessions. 

I know its rushed but imo our worst enemy is ... Rushing.   mini/smile
